Bar X Construction designs and builds outdoor living spaces for Oklahoma City homeowners who want more from their backyard. We handle decks, covered patios, pergolas, shade structures, fire pit areas, and outdoor seating zones built as one connected space. Oklahoma City's climate puts real stress on outdoor structures. Hot summers, ice storms, heavy rain, and high winds all affect how materials hold up over time. We account for all of that before a single board goes in. Oklahoma's expansive clay soil also requires solid footings and proper drainage grading so structures stay level and stable season after season. Every project starts with your yard's layout, your home's style, and how you plan to use the space. Whether you host large groups or want a quiet spot for your family, we build to fit your life. Outdoor Living Space Construction FAQ
Common questions about outdoor living space construction in Oklahoma City, OK.
Yes, we design and build decks and covered patios as one connected outdoor living space. Combining both in a single project gives your Oklahoma City backyard a more functional and finished layout.
Clay soil in Oklahoma City expands and contracts with moisture, which can shift footings over time. We engineer support posts and foundations to account for soil movement so your structure stays level and stable.
We build decks, covered patios, pergolas, shade structures, fire pit areas, and outdoor seating zones. Each project is designed around your yard's layout and how you plan to use the space.
We select and build with materials suited to Oklahoma City's full range of weather, including summer heat, heavy rain, ice storms, and wind. Proper drainage grading and solid structural support are part of every build.
No, you do not need a plan before reaching out. We work with Oklahoma City homeowners from the early planning stage to understand your yard, your goals, and your home's style before any design decisions are made.
Yes, we can assess your existing deck and add a pergola or covered structure to it. This is a common request from Oklahoma City homeowners who want to use their outdoor space more during hot months.
